Title:
OPTICALLY CONTROLLED ELECTROSTATIC INDUCTION THYRISTOR

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To simplify a driving circuit and improve switching characteristics, by cascade-connecting photosensitive devices such as electrostatic induction phototransistor to an electrostatic induction thyristor and connecting a gate to a drain between the photosensitive devices and connecting a zener diode.

CONSTITUTION: A primary electrostatic induction phototransistor (SIPT) Q13 is Darlington-connected to an auxiliary SIPT Q14 and is cascade-connected to an electrostatic induction thyristor (SI) Q10. A cathode of the SI Q10 is connected to a source commonly connected to the SIPTs Q13 and Q14 of N channel, and a drain of the SIPT Q14 is connected to a gate of the SIPT Q13, and an anode and a cathode of a zener diode ZD is respectively connected between a gate of the SI Q10 and the source of the SIPT Q13. Resistors R2 and R3 are respectively connected between the gate and drain of the SIPTs Q13 and Q14. Accordingly, a variable control current can be increased.
